CompTIA Security+ (SY0-701) — Question 227
Which of the following most likely describes why a security engineer would configure all outbound emails to use S/MIME digital signatures?
Answer options
- A. To meet compliance standards
- B. To increase delivery rates
- C. To block phishing attacks
- D. To ensure non-repudiation
Correct answer: D
Explanation
The correct answer is D, as S/MIME digital signatures ensure that the sender cannot deny sending the email, thus providing non-repudiation. Options A and B do not directly relate to the primary function of S/MIME, while C, although related to security, does not specifically address the non-repudiation aspect that S/MIME provides.
